iPhone restarts when on locked screen.

Good day!

My wife’s iOS 10.3.3 16gb White iPhone 6 started doing random restarts like every 2-5 minutes when the phone is locked. It never restarts when it’s not locked. I did some testing, first i connected new battery it did not help, then i’ve installed whole screen from another working iPhone 6, still does random reboots. I even checked leaving any specific application in background before doing lock, does not seem to be related to any of apps.

We also did “full erase”, which did not help.

I’ve checked analytics there are some “panic-full” messages referencing to some “SEP ROM boot” and “timeout waiting for SEP reply to SLEEP control message”. Could not find any information regarding it on the web.

EDIT: I found that phone may have been damaged by a child in the left bottom corner.

Found out that slightly unbending it from down under caused restarts appear less frequently. But what hardware malfunction may this be?

So after many different attempts finally i’ve decided to do hard reset & update it to iOS 12.

Nothing has changed, still reboots when locked.

Even with all the stuff below motherboard deattached it still reboots randomly and only while its locked. Even with different screen (w/o camera nor touch id) + battery attached. Still searching what may be triggered during these "SEP ROM Boot" & “timeout waiting for SEP reply to SLEEP control message” panics.

To conclude:

I’ve sent this phone to professional repairs. They found some faulty chip. Replacement cost would’ve been 3/4 of iPhone itself. Trashed it.
